Hi English Teachers,
Can I use ‘create’ to replace ‘set up’ and do the sentences have the same meaning? Thanks a lot in advance.
I suggest that you all set up an online advanced course.
I suggest that you all create an online advanced course.

@Loh Jane,
Don't see much difference except that they might set up a course that actually exists whereas they'd create one entirely new
